Transaction 31dbd586fbb5f0bd373afccbfe824d74bef86fc1cd7b63e384246859d055bb18
1 Input
1 Output
-
31dbd586fbb5f0bd373afccbfe824d74bef86fc1cd7b63e384246859d055bb18:0
- value
- 40520
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b8e6c93f6ba5900e712ce94ff39649f7bbb2941 OP_EQUAL
- address
- 377vQfTsXsBU5JZoUs1p6kDGSd9vPaniUt